The Red Lion Inn & Restaurant - A pet-friendly inn with a garden, playground, and on-site British restaurant

The Red Lion Inn & Restaurant offers accommodation with a garden, free private parking, and a children's playground. Rooms at the inn include a desk, TV, wardrobe, and carpeted floors. A British cuisine restaurant and bar are available on-site. The property provides free WiFi and luggage storage space. Located 2 km from Prestatyn High Street, the inn is 33 km from Llandudno Pier and 80 km from Liverpool John Lennon Airport. Nearby attractions include The Roman Bath House (0.5 km) and Prestatyn Golf Club (3 km). Breakfast is served at The Red Lion Inn & Restaurant.
